Interesting facts about buses that you may not know

  • In 2016, the fastest bus on the planet, called the “Superbus,” is found in Dubai and goes over 255kmph! It covers the 150km between Dubai and Abu Dhabi in just 30 minutes.
  • Some operators in Europe offer food and drink service on board and sometimes even have coffee. You might ask yourself “Am I on a plane?”
  • Unlike airports, bus stations are usually located downtown, another benefit of bus travel. Forget going out of the way to get to the airport, often located on the far edges of the city.
  • In the United States, an electric bus accomplished a new feat by traveling 1120 kilometers within 24 hours with an average speed of 45kmph.
  • Buses have provided the inspiration for many movies, such as: Speed, The We and the I, Bus Palladium, Into the Wild, and more.
